HINDS: History and Genealogy of the Hinds Family 1899
By Albert Hinds
The early origin of the surname Hind, Hinde, Hinds, from hyne or hine, means a tiller of the ground, or farmer. This history and genealogy of the Hinds Family begins with the emigrant to America, James Hinds (Heynes, Haynes, Hindes), who landed in Salem as early as 1637. He married in 1638. Descendants are given to 1899.
